CMD脚本语言语法详解:批处理的艺术50
CMD脚本,也称为批处理脚本,是基于Windows命令行解释器的脚本语言。它允许用户通过编写一系列命令来自动化Windows系统的操作,例如文件管理、程序运行、系统配置等等。虽然相比于更高级的编程语言,CMD脚本的功能相对有限,但其简洁易用、无需编译的特点使其成为快速完成简单任务的理想工具。本文将深入探讨CMD脚本的语法,帮助读者掌握其核心要素,进而编写高效、可靠的批处理脚本。
一、基本语法结构
CMD脚本的核心是命令行指令。每个指令占据一行,指令可以包含参数和选项。指令之间可以使用分号`;`来分隔,同一行可以写多个指令。脚本文件的后缀名通常为`.bat`或`.cmd`。例如,一个简单的脚本可以如下编写:
@echo off
echo Hello, world!
pause
@echo off 命令关闭命令回显,防止脚本执行过程中的命令显示在屏幕上;echo Hello, world! 命令将文字输出到控制台;pause 命令暂停脚本执行,等待用户按下任意键继续。 这些都是CMD脚本中常用的基本指令。
二、变量的使用
CMD脚本支持变量的使用,方便存储和操作数据。变量名不区分大小写,使用`%变量名%`的方式访问变量的值。变量赋值可以使用`set`命令,例如:
set myVar=Hello
echo %myVar%
这段脚本会将字符串"Hello"赋值给变量myVar,然后输出变量myVar的值。 需要注意的是,CMD脚本的变量通常是字符串类型的。如果需要进行数值运算,需要借助一些特殊的方法,例如使用set /a命令进行算术运算:
set /a sum=10+5
echo %sum%
三、条件语句
CMD脚本使用if语句实现条件判断。if语句的基本语法如下:
if condition command
其中condition是条件表达式,command是当条件满足时执行的命令。 条件表达式可以使用比较运算符,例如==(等于)、!=(不等于)、>(大于)、=(大于等于)、
2025-03-05

JavaScript安全攻防:深入浅出前端安全实践
https://jb123.cn/javascript/44550.html

Perl 0和1:深入理解Perl中的真值与逻辑运算
https://jb123.cn/perl/44549.html

高效文件处理:用脚本编程实现文件编辑的技巧与实践
https://jb123.cn/jiaobenbiancheng/44548.html

太空工程师编程:从入门到进阶的脚本编写指南
https://jb123.cn/jiaobenbiancheng/44547.html

Perl语言Getopt::Long模块详解:高效处理命令行参数
https://jb123.cn/perl/44546.html
热门文章

脚本语言:让计算机自动化执行任务的秘密武器
https://jb123.cn/jiaobenyuyan/6564.html

快速掌握产品脚本语言,提升产品力
https://jb123.cn/jiaobenyuyan/4094.html

Tcl 脚本语言项目
https://jb123.cn/jiaobenyuyan/25789.html

脚本语言的力量:自动化、效率提升和创新
https://jb123.cn/jiaobenyuyan/25712.html

PHP脚本语言在网站开发中的广泛应用
https://jb123.cn/jiaobenyuyan/20786.html